Here's a breakdown of some popular lengths and things to consider:
Short (Chin Length or Above):
* Pros:
* Trendy and can be edgy
* Easy to manage and style (often)
* Can be a great way to try something new and bold
* Cons:
* Can be difficult to style in certain ways (like ponytails)
* Might require more frequent trims to maintain the shape
Medium (Shoulder Length to Collarbone):
* Pros:
* Versatile: Can be worn up or down, styled straight, wavy, or curly
* Generally easy to manage
* Flattering for many face shapes
* Cons:
* May need more styling to avoid looking shapeless
Long (Below the Collarbone):
* Pros:
* Classic and feminine
* Offers lots of styling options (braids, buns, ponytails, etc.)
* Cons:
* Requires more maintenance (washing, conditioning, brushing)
* Can take longer to dry
* May be more prone to tangling
Factors to Consider:
* Hair Type: Fine hair might look fuller with shorter layers, while thick hair might benefit from longer layers to reduce bulk. Curly hair can often look shorter than it actually is.
* Face Shape: Some lengths and styles flatter certain face shapes more than others. A stylist can help determine what works best.
* Lifestyle: Is she active in sports? Does she have a lot of time to spend styling her hair in the morning? Shorter or easily manageable styles might be better.
* Personal Style: Does she prefer a more classic, edgy, bohemian, or trendy look?
* Maintenance: How much time and effort is she willing to put into washing, styling, and maintaining her hair?
* School Rules/Activities: Check for any school rules regarding hair length or style. If she participates in sports, make sure the hair length allows for easy tying back.
